Output 9434efae4f617428616315bc412b4e6ef29c87e247fe4211684442e1df9ad08e:1

value
1042991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9716eca9f1b8355906d0371be5e58a620114f0e7 OP_EQUAL
address
3FTuRL6mbNWxZ63cY47Qi22mmGyqXZhTbS
transaction
9434efae4f617428616315bc412b4e6ef29c87e247fe4211684442e1df9ad08e
spent
true